For me, the more annoying thing about using software tools is that I learn to use them and start to integrate them into my workflow, but when I download the latest update, the designers of the tools have changed how it operates, so iit breaks the model of the workflow I have created inside my head.

Means that I have to learn it all over again, which is a waste of my cognitive bandwidth... :|

It also means that I am less inclined to trust that specific tool in future, as I don't know when it will change in unexpected ways.

That lack of trust is what destroys the future use of those tools.

If the designer of a tools explicitly says, "It's in Beta!", then it's fine as I will expect it to change, and there's a possibility of influencing that change. :D

But, if it's a full release, and the updates break the existing workflow, then why would I bother trusting it in future?

Especially when it's commercial software, as the people making those decisions are doing the exact opposite of what their job is supposed to be... :|
